MOZAMBIQUE: African leaders meet with experts on AIDS gel
African leaders and international health experts met in the Mozambican capital, Maputo, this week to discuss ongoing efforts to develop a gel that protects women against HIV infection.
Former Mozambican first lady Graca Machel, who was part of the delegation, stressed the importance of investing in tools such as microbicides to fight the pandemic.
"The battle against HIV/AIDS can be won ... [but] the world needs to act now to commit the resources and political will to scale up research and development for microbicides," media association PRNewswire quoted Machel as saying.
Members of the Group of Eight (G8) industrialised nations have been urged to increase investment in microbicide research and development to help slow HIV infection rates among women in developing countries.
